It shouldn't last for long but there's 2-3cm of snow at resort base areas, more of a dusting in some areas around the village. Clearer skies are due later... and tomorrow.
Earlier this week, Hakuba Happo-one and Tsugaike Kogen both closed for the season within a day of the 'state of emergency' being announced by the Japanese government for Tokyo and six other regions of the country.
I was wondering how the two remaining ski resorts would react, and yesterday we found out. Hakuba 47 made clear of their intention to remain open - at least for the time being. They made various reassurances about offering hand sanitizer, staff wearing masks, keeping windows open, limiting the number of people in each gondola cabin, etc.
So for the moment, Hakuba 47 (almost fully open) and Hakuba Goryu (top area and the narrow Toomi run open) remain in operation.

Hakuba Now 2019-2020 season |
Data as of Friday 10th April 2020 Total snowfall at base so far 223cm Number of days snowfall observed at base 41 days Most snowfall observed in 1 day 16cm (5th January) November 2019 snowfall 4cm reported on 1 day December 2019 snowfall 28cm reported on 8 days January 2020 snowfall 70cm reported on 13 days February 2020 snowfall 73cm reported on 9 days March 2020 snowfall 46cm reported on 9 days April 2020 snowfall 2cm reported on 1 day |
All snowfall data presented on this page is the snowfall measured and observed at base/town level by our reporter based in Hakuba. The 'new snowfall' number represents the amount of snow measured since the previous report. All opinions are those of the individual reporters.
